How much do web production j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for web production in the United States is $38.46,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$36.06 and $40.87 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a typical day look like for someone working in Web Production?

A typical day in Web Production often involves updating website content, coordinating digital assets, testing web pages for quality assurance, and troubleshooting formatting or technical issues. You’ll work closely with designers, developers, and marketing teams to ensure that content aligns with project goals and brand standards. The role may require handling multiple projects simultaneously and responding quickly to urgent web updates or changes. This dynamic environment offers a great opportunity to develop both technical and communication skills while contributing to the company’s online presence.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Web Production position, and why are they important?

To excel in Web Production, you need strong skills in web content management, HTML/CSS, and digital asset coordination, often supported by a degree in communications, digital media, or a related field. Familiarity with content management systems (CMS) like WordPress or Drupal, as well as pro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ite and basic SEO tools, are typically required. Attention to detail, time management, and effective collaboration set top performers apart. These abilities are crucial for maintaining high-quality, on-brand web content in a fast-paced digital environment.

What is a Web Production job?

A Web Production job involves managing and publishing digital content for websites, ensuring that pages are properly formatted, functional, and optimized for user experience. Responsibilities often include updating site content, troubleshooting technical issues, and coordinating with designers, developers, and marketing teams. Professionals in this role must have skills in CMS platforms, basic HTML/CSS, and SEO best practices. The goal is to maintain a seamless, engaging, and efficient web presence for businesses or organizations.

Job description

Position: Web Operations Specialist
Department: Creative Services
Reporting to: Web Design Art Director
Location: Topeka, KS - Onsite
Overview:
Are you passionate about web operations, process improvement, and creating exceptional digital experiences? As a Web Operations Specialist, you'll help drive the workflows, systems, and quality standards that support our advisor and corporate websites.
You'll collaborate with Designers, Developers, Account Managers, and Production Artists to streamline website requests, improve processes, and ensure projects are delivered with accuracy, consistency, and efficiency.
If you enjoy solving problems, improving workflows, and making a measurable impact on the success of a growing web team, we'd love to hear from you.
What you'll do:
  • Oversee daily web operations, including website maintenance workflows, ticket management, prioritization, and escalations
  • Review and route website requests to ensure work is assigned appropriately and completed efficiently
  • Monitor workflow performance and identify opportunities to improve quality, consistency, and service delivery
  • Establish and maintain quality assurance standards for website updates, functionality, accessibility, and user experience
  • Support the ongoing maintenance and health of advisor and corporate websites, including content updates, forms, integrations, and technical SEO considerations
  • Partner with Designers, Developers, Systems Specialists, and Account Managers to resolve issues and improve processes
  • Create and maintain documentation, SOPs, training materials, and workflow standards
  • Train and provide day-to-day guidance to Production Artists, interns, and other team members supporting website operations
  • Help identify opportunities to automate, standardize, and scale recurring web processes

Experience you'll bring:
  • Experience coordinating web production, website maintenance, digital operations, or a related web support function
  • Strong working knowledge of WordPress and website content management workflows
  • Ability to evaluate website requests and determine appropriate priorities, routing, and level of effort
  • Understanding of website production standards, accessibility, technical SEO fundamentals, forms, integrations, hosting environments, and quality assurance practices
  • Experience leading projects, processes, or team workflows
  • Strong organizational, communication, and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ment
  • Experience working with ticketing systems, project management tools, and documentation platforms

Bonus Points:
  • Experience supporting a large portfolio of websites in an agency, in-house creative team, SaaS, financial services, franchise, or multi-location business environment
  • Experience with tools such as WP Engine, Flywheel, Beaver Builder, Webflow, Figma, Relume, Gravity Forms, Jotform, or HighLevel
  • Familiarity with ADA accessibility standards and regulated-industry marketing environments
  • Experience developing SOPs, workflow documentation, quality assurance standards, and training materials
  • Experience mentoring junior team members or supporting operational process improvements
